Del-Ton Sierra 316 AR-15 Semi Auto Rifle 5.56 NATO 16" Barrel 30 Rounds M-LOK Handguard Collapsible Stock OD Green/Black RFTMH16MLOKOD RFTMH16MLOKOD

UPC:
848456002250
MPN:
RFTMH16MLOKOD
Scroll to top